| 产品名称: | Corynebacterium glutamicum (Kinoshita et al.) Abe et al. |
|---|---|
| 商品货号: | TS207068 |
| Deposited As: | Micrococcus glutamicus Kinoshita et al. |
| Strain Designations: | 541 NCIB 10026 |
| Application: | Produces glutamic acid L-glutamate, L-glutamic acid, glutamate |
| Isolation: | Derived from ATCC 13032 |
| Biosafety Level: | 1

| Product Format: | freeze-dried |
| Storage Conditions: | Frozen: -80°C or colder Freeze-Dried: 2°C to 8°C Live Culture: See Propagation Section |

| Comments: | Requires biotin |
| Medium: | ATCC® Medium 3: Nutrient agar or nutrient broth |
| Growth Conditions: | Temperature: 37°C
Atmosphere: Aerobic |
